    Market Segmentation Market Segmentation means breaking down the total market into self contained and relatively homogeneous subgroups of customers‚ each possessing its own special requirements and characteristics. This enables the company to modify its output‚ advertising messages and promotional methods to correspond to the needs of particular segments. Accurate segmentation allows the firm to pinpoint selling opportunities and to tailors it’s marketing activities to satisfy on consumer needs.

    first opened by Adolph Coors‚ Sr.‚ in Golden Colorado in 1873‚ and then Adolph Coors‚ Jr.‚ stepped in 1929 when his father died. In 1933‚ prohibition was repealed and Coors sold as many as 90‚000 barrels of beers‚ and began to expand outside Colorado by adding Arizona to its distribution territory. During the 1930s‚ Coors also expanding their territory onto eight other western states: Idaho‚ California‚ Kansas‚ New Mexico‚ Nevada‚ Utah‚ Oklahoma‚ and Wyoming.
